Meet the Management Team at BioTe Veterinary Laboratories

Tiffany Baker BSc (hons) MSc
Laboratory Manager
Tiffany gained her BSc (hons) Equine from Portsmouth University and graduated in 2012. After graduating, she took a year out, working and playing for a polo club before completing her masters degree in Veterinary Microbiology at Surrey University (School of Veterinary Medicine) graduating in 2014.
She was then involved in a research program at The Pirbright Institute to research African Horse Sickness Virus (control measures) and published a paper in 'Journal of Parasites and Vectors' (Baker et al. Parasites & Vectors (2015) 8:604).
Her main interest is in PCR which she has extensive background in, along with serology. Having grown up on a farm, having her own dog and having owned polo ponies, she has a direct interest in all species diagnostics. Tiffany has worked in various large veterinary diagnostic laboratories and has joins BioTe as our Laboratory Manager.

Ellie Wareham BSc (hons) and MRes
Laboratory Technician
Ellie graduated from the University of the West of England in 2019 with a BSc (Honours) in Biological Science and after taking a year out to travel went on to complete a Master of Research degree specialising in Microbiology in 2021 from the University of Southampton.
She has worked as a Microbiology Laboratory Assistant and has a particular interest in bacteriology and biofilms.
